Prestige Springwood rental yield is 3.0% to 3.8% each year, while the expected 5-year Return on Investment (ROI) is 58% to 75% due to fast growth near the Bangalore airport corridor. The project is in Yerthiganahalli, Devanahalli (Pin Code: 562110) across 9 acres with just 60 luxury G+2 row villas. Prices start at ₹10 Crores for the 4,000 sq ft Royale Townhouse and reach ₹12.5 Crores for the 5,000 sq ft Magnus Townhouse.

The base rate is ₹25,000 per sq ft, and monthly rent is estimated between ₹2,60,000 and ₹3,80,000. Strong demand comes from top bosses and experts working in KIADB Aerospace Park and Kempegowda Airport. Land prices along NH-44 rise by 9% to 11% every year, making this a safe choice to grow wealth.

Most standard flats in Bangalore give only 2% to 3% rent returns. These luxury villas give better total gains because you own a big share of land in a private community. The area is just 600 metres from NH-44 and 3.5 km from the airport toll gate. This prime spot keeps homes full and helps prices climb steadily.

Gross vs. Net Rental Yield Breakdown by Villa Layout


Prestige Springwood gives a gross rent yield of 3.24% on the 4,000 sq ft Royale villa and 3.41% on the 5,000 sq ft Magnus villa, which leaves a net yield of 2.86% and 3.03% after basic costs.

Investment Metric Royale Townhouse (4 BHK – 4,000 sq ft) Magnus Townhouse (4 BHK – 5,000 sq ft)
Buying Price ₹10,00,00,000 (₹10.00 Cr) ₹12,50,00,000 (₹12.50 Cr)
Rate per Sq Ft ₹25,000 / sq ft ₹25,000 / sq ft
Estimated Monthly Rent ₹2,70,000 ₹3,55,000
Gross Yearly Rent ₹32,40,000 ₹42,60,000
Gross Rental Yield 3.24% 3.41%
Maintenance & Tax ₹3,80,000 ₹4,75,000
Net Yearly Rent Cash ₹28,60,000 ₹37,85,000
Net Rental Yield 2.86% 3.03%
  • Royale Townhouse Cash Flow: The 4,000 sq ft unit costs ₹10 Crores and brings in ₹32.40 Lakhs every year before costs.
  • Magnus Townhouse Cash Flow: The 5,000 sq ft home earns up to ₹3.55 Lakhs each month from corporate leaders.
  • Low Upkeep Burden: Community maintenance fees take less than 11% of the total rent each year, leaving healthy cash in hand.

Projected 5-Year and 10-Year ROI & Capital Appreciation


Total Return on Investment (ROI) hits 74.1% in 5 years and 198% in 10 years, assuming local land values grow at a steady 10% each year in Devanahalli.

Time Horizon Villa Value (at 10% Growth) Total Net Rent Collected Total Value (Price + Rent) Total ROI (%)
Year 1 ₹11.00 Cr ₹0.28 Cr ₹11.28 Cr 12.8%
Year 3 ₹13.31 Cr ₹0.91 Cr ₹14.22 Cr 42.2%
Year 5 ₹16.10 Cr ₹1.61 Cr ₹17.71 Cr 77.1%
Year 7 ₹19.48 Cr ₹2.42 Cr ₹21.90 Cr 119.0%
Year 10 ₹25.93 Cr ₹3.88 Cr ₹29.81 Cr 198.1%
  • Faster Land Value Growth: Landed villas gain value faster than high-rise flats because land is limited near the airport.
  • Built-In Rent Rise: Lease contracts in this area raise the rent by 5% every year or 10% every 2 years, lifting your take-home cash over time.
  • Beating Price Rise: Owning physical property in a secure gated project protects your funds from inflation.

Micro-Market Drivers of Rental Demand and Yield Stability


Rental yield stays strong because the project is only 3.5 km from Bangalore Airport and close to 120,000 high-paying jobs in the aerospace and tech parks.

  • Top Company Executives: Being just 600 metres from NH-44 draws airline heads, business directors, and global managers.
  • Very Few Villas for Rent: Luxury row homes make up less than 6% of local housing, keeping villas occupied without long empty gaps.
  • Better Roads and Metro: The Satellite Town Ring Road and the coming Airport Metro line make daily travel easy for tenants.
  • Top Schools Nearby: Good international schools like Stonehill and Canadian International School make families stay for multiple years.

Comparative Rental Yield Analysis: Row Villas vs. Multi-Storey Apartments


Luxury row villas at Prestige Springwood attract longer-staying tenants and higher capital gains than dense apartment towers in Devanahalli.

Feature Prestige Springwood Villas High-Rise Flats Nearby
Gross Rent Return 3.0% – 3.8% 2.4% – 3.0%
Yearly Price Rise 9.5% – 11.0% 6.5% – 8.0%
Average Stay of Tenant 3 to 5 Years 1 to 2 Years
Total Units on Land 60 homes on 9 acres 1,000+ homes on similar land
Price Control on Resale High (Rare supply) Medium (Too many flats)
  • Tenants Stay Longer: Families in row villas settle down for 3 to 5 years, which cuts down on empty months.
  • Fewer Agent Fees: Longer tenant stays mean you pay fewer agent fees and spend less money on repainting every year.
